Fire Country often has its cast members pulling double duty with two different roles on the show.
Jordan Calloway is the latest actor to add a new role to his resume for the hit CBS drama. Not only does Calloway play Jake on Fire Country, but he’s stepping behind the camera for the next episode.
The news was announced via the official Fire Country Instagram page. Several photos of Calloway in director mode were featured in the Instagram post.
“Lights, camera, Calloway! 🎬 #behindthescenes of @j_calloway6 making his directorial debut on #FireCountry! #tvshow #drama #action,” read the caption on the social media share.

Calloway’s directorial debut is set for Episode 4 titled “Like a Wounded Wildebeest.” According to a press release, the synopsis for the episode reads, “Manny has a serious conversation with Bode about a troubling discovery, urging him to be honest and take responsibility.”
Other members of the Fire Country cast who have taken on dual roles include Kevin Alejandro. Like Calloway, Alejandro has also showcased his skills behind the camera, having directed several episodes throughout the series.
Max Thieriot doesn’t just play Bode on the CBS drama; he’s also one of the Fire Country creators.
